5.0 out of 5 stars A collection you don't want to miss, January 14, 2006
This review is from: Wild Things (Hardcover)
If this book only contained Finlay's brilliant Nebula and Hugo Award-nominated reinvention of space opera, "The Political Officer," it would be worth buying for that story alone. But fortunately, the book's also got thirteen other compelling and finely-crafted tales, which run the gamut from humor to alternate history to swords-and-sorcery. This variety makes for an interesting reading experience, as if Finlay wanted to take the reader on a tour through all of what science fiction and fantasy has to offer. And Finlay seems equally adept at each of the subgenres he explores, so it's not a matter of him trying new things until he finds something that works; it's more like having written a great story in one subgenre, he goes looking for new kingdoms to conquer.
